Bahrain - Total Upper Secondary Education School Age Population
Since 2014, Bahrain Total Upper Secondary Education School Age Population jumped by 1.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 148 among other countries in Total Upper Secondary Education School Age Population with 56,947 Persons. Bahrain is overtaken by Swaziland, which was number 147 with 59,617 Persons and is followed by Solomon Islands with 54,926 Persons. India topped the ranking with 101,798,647.02 Persons in 2019, an increase of 0.6% compared to 2018. China, Pakistan and Indonesia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Gambia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+4.3% per year, while Latvia witnessed the worst performance at -7.8% per year.
